/* type directors club :: http://www.tdc.org :: print style sheet for TDC2 2007  */

body {margin-left: 0; margin-right: 0; margin-top: 0; margin-bottom: 0; background:#ffffff; background-image: url(glyphs/background.gif); background-attachment: fixed; background-position:center center; background-repeat: no-repeat; font-family:  "Really Pan European", "Georgia", "Constantia", "Palatino",   "Palatino Linotype", Frutiger, Minion,  Arial, sans-serif; font-size:9pt;}

h1, h2, h3, h4, h5, h6 {font-family:  "Maiandra", "Maiandra GD", "Maiandra Pro GD","Lucida Bright",    "ClearviewOne", Frutiger, Myriad,  Arial, sans-serif; }
.header {background-image:url(glyphs/tint.gif); margin:0; padding:0; border-top:1px solid #ffeed6; border-bottom:2px solid #ffeed6;   }
.headcontent {padding-top:3px; padding-right:1em; padding-left:43px;  padding-bottom:1em; }
.header H2 {Font-Size : 85% ; color: #ff8300; margin:0; padding-bottom:0;padding-left:20px; padding-top:5px; } 
.mainlogo {width:260px; float:left;}
h1.logo  {margin: 0; padding:0; width:250px; border:none; }


.content {float:left; width:50%; margin:1em; background-image: url(glyphs/tint.gif); margin-left:60px;  border-top:2px solid #ffeed6;border-bottom:2px solid #ffeed6;}
.innercontent {padding:0; margin:0; padding-left:3em;padding-right:1em;padding-bottom:1em;}
.mainlinkcontent {float:right; width:20%; margin:1em; background-image: url(glyphs/tint.gif); border-top:2px solid #ffeed6;border-bottom:2px solid #ffeed6;}
.linkcontent {padding-left:1em; padding-right:1em;padding-bottom:1em;}
.footer {background-image:url(glyphs/tint.gif); margin:0; padding:0; width:100%; text-align:right;  clear:both; border-top:2px solid #ffeed6;border-bottom:2px solid #ffeed6; display:none;}
.endcontent {padding-top:3px; padding-bottom:1em;}
.footer p br {display:none;}
.footer p {margin:1em; padding-right:43px; max-width:100%; }
H1 {Font-Size : 150% ; font-weight: bold; color: #ff8300; margin-bottom: 0; padding-bottom:0;}
H2 {Font-Size : 85% ; margin-left:22px;color: #ff8300; margin-bottom: 0; padding-bottom:0;}
H3 {Font-Size : 120% ; color: #ff8300; margin-bottom: 0; padding-bottom:0;}
H4 {Font-Size: 100% ; color: #ff8300; margin-bottom: 0; padding-bottom:0;}
H5 {Font-Size: 85% ; color: #ff8300; margin-bottom: 0; padding-bottom:0;}
H6 {Font-Size: 85% ; color: #ff8300; margin-bottom: 0; padding-bottom:0;}

H4+img {padding-top:1em;}

strong {color: #ff8300; font-family:  "Maiandra GD", "Maiandra Pro GD","Lucida Bright",    "ClearviewOne", Frutiger, Myriad,  Arial, sans-serif; } 
th { color: #a99999; }
dt  {color: #a99999; }
td { color: #a99999; }

p { margin:0; padding-left:3em; color: #111111; line-height:1.5em; max-width:30em; margin-bottom:1.5em;}
p small {padding-left:0; color:#111111; line-height:1.5em; max-width:30em;}
.linkcontent p  {padding-left:0; color:#111111; line-height:1.5em; max-width:30em; padding-left:1em;}
.superior {font-size:90%; vertical-align:15%;line-height:1.5em;}
blockquote {color: #111111;  padding-left:2em; padding-right:0; max-width:22em; line-height:1.5em; margin:auto;}
cite {color: #111111; }
h3 cite {color: #997700; }
h4 cite {color: #997700; }

.alert {color:#ff8300;}
.alertborder {border:2px solid #ff8300;}
.notice {border:2px solid #000000; }

input {background:#eeeeee;color:#997700; border:1px solid #666666;}
select {background:#eeeeee;color:#997700; }
textarea {background:#eeeeee;color:#997700; }

ol, ul, li, li p  {color: #222222; max-width:30em; line-height:1.25em; margin:0; margin-left:2em; padding:0; }
dl, dd, dd p  {color: #222222; max-width:30em; line-height:1.25em; margin-top: 0; padding-top:0;}

ul li {list-style-image:url(glyphs/bullets.gif); }

a:link   {padding:2px; text-decoration:none; background:#ffeed6; color: #000000; }
a:visited {padding:2px; text-decoration:none; background:#ffeed6; color: #ff8300; }
a:hover  {padding:2px; text-decoration: none; color: #ffffff;  background:#ff8300;}
a:hover img {background:#ffffff;}
a:active {padding:2px; text-decoration: none; color: #ff8300; background:#ffeed6;}
a:active img {background:#ffffff;}


.logo a:link {background:transparent;}
.logo a:visited  {background:transparent;}
.logo  a:hover  {background:transparent; }
.logo  a:active {background:transparent;}
.logo a img {background-image: none;background:transparent;}


